CentOS7解决MySQL Workbench打不开闪退

本文介绍了解决在Linux环境下安装MySQL Workbench后无法打开的问题。通过卸载较高版本并安装mysql-workbench-community-6.2.5-1.el7.x86_64.rpm,最终成功启动软件。文章提供了具体的下载和安装命令。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

按照网上的教程安装依赖后,安装mysql-workbench-community-6.3.10-1.el7.x86_64.rpm。

安装结束后却发现无论如何打不开MySQL Workbench,要么没有反映,要么闪退。

最后把mysql-workbench-community-6.3.10-1.el7.x86_64.rpm给卸载了,安装mysql-workbench-community-6.2.5-1.el7.x86_64.rpm,终于打开了。

进入你想下载到的位置

cd /home

下载

wget https://dev.mysql.com/get/Downloads/MySQLGUITools/mysql-workbench-community-6.2.5-1.el7.x86_64.rpm

安装

rpm -ivh mysql-workbench-community-6.2.5-1.el7.x86_64.rpm

安装后不要升级MySQL Workbench,否则版本更新后依然打不开,如果不小心升级了就只有卸载重装了。

转载于:https://my.oschina.net/ZhenyuanLiu/blog/1784735

### 安装 MySQL Workbench 的步骤 要在 CentOS 7 操作系统上安装 MySQL Workbench,首先需要确保系统已更新,并且已经安装了必要的依赖项。以下是详细的安装步骤: 1. **更新系统** 在安装任何软件之前,建议先更新系统以获取最新的软件包和安全补丁。可以通过运行以下命令来更新系统: ```bash sudo yum update ``` 2. **安装 MySQL Repository** 由于 CentOS 7 的默认仓库中没有 MySQL Workbench,因此需要手动添加 MySQL 官方仓库。可以通过下载并安装 MySQL 社区版的仓库配置文件来完成此操作: ```bash wget http://dev.mysql.com/get/mysql-community-release-el7-5.noarch.rpm sudo rpm -ivh mysql-community-release-el7-5.noarch.rpm ``` 这一步骤会将 MySQL 的仓库信息添加到系统的 YUM 配置中,使得可以通过 YUM 命令安装 MySQL 相关的软件包 [^3]。 3. **安装 MySQL Workbench** 添加完 MySQL 仓库后,可以使用 YUM 命令安装 MySQL Workbench。运行以下命令开始安装: ```bash sudo yum install mysql-workbench ``` 在安装过程中,可能会遇到警告信息,例如 `Header V3 DSA/SHA1 Signature, key ID 5072e1f5: NOKEY`。这是因为系统没有验证 MySQL 软件包的签名密钥。如果确定下载的软件包是可信的,可以直接忽略这个警告,继续安装 [^2]。 4. **启动 MySQL Workbench** 安装完成后,可以通过图形界面或者命令行启动 MySQL Workbench: ```bash mysql-workbench ``` 启动后,用户可以使用 MySQL Workbench 的图形界面进行数据库管理和操作,包括连接数据库、执行 SQL 查询、设计数据库结构等 [^1]。 ### 注意事项 - **依赖项检查** 在安装 MySQL Workbench 之前,确保系统中已安装所有必要的依赖项。如果遇到依赖项问题,可以尝试运行 `sudo yum install` 命令来自动解决依赖关系。 - **安全性考虑** 安装完成后,建议定期检查 MySQL WorkbenchMySQL 服务器的安全更新,确保系统的安全性。 - **配置 MySQL 服务器** 如果需要在本地运行 MySQL 服务器,还需要安装 MySQL 服务器软件包,并进行相应的配置。可以通过以下命令安装 MySQL 服务器: ```bash sudo yum install mysql-community-server ``` 安装完成后,启动 MySQL 服务并设置开机自启: ```bash sudo systemctl start mysqld sudo systemctl enable mysqld ``` 通过以上步骤,可以在 CentOS 7 操作系统上成功安装并配置 MySQL Workbench,从而方便地进行数据库管理和开发工作。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值